My problem is, that I'm trying the integration of an Cisco TelePresence Manager into our TP network.
I read all the information on the cisco website, and did everything, what is writen there, but I get error everywhere.
At the CUCM integration, I made the user,I made the group, I added the roles as writen, but at the CTS configuration website I'm getting the following error:
Failed to establish a connection to 'XX' with the information provided.
Code: 501000.
Message: The system has encountered an unexpected condition (com.cisco.ts.scheduler.exception.DiscoveryException(502406,DM,CCM_AUTH_CONN_FAILURE,Unable to authenticate and connect with Unified CM 'XX' because Invalid application user credential.)).
I used a simpley user password, I downloaded the cerficate file, as writen in the documentation.

"Make sure under CUCM System its configured to use an IP address"
Can you confirm above (CUCM Admin | System | Server) , as if CTS-Manager is not able to resolve CUCM name, it will fail with a similar error
Once you confirmed this, make sure Roles:
Standard AXL API Access
CCMAdmin Users
CTI Enabled
RealtimeandTraceCollection
Serviceability
CUCM,CTI and AXL services must be restarted after this,
confirm password
then restart CTS-Man

Problem resolved here.
The error message is strange as the problem came from the certificate. I re-downloaded it from my browser on the cucm web page then uploaded it for the test connection page in ctsmanager and that works fine.
05-02-2011 01:33 AM
I think the certificate is the problem here too. Which certificate did you downloaded exacly?
You did nothing jus re downloaded?
05-02-2011 01:49 AM
Actually i logged on my cucm admin webpage then clicked on the blue part of the url (connexion secured). Then i applied these steps given by someone from cisco:
For downloading the new certificate from CUCM and then upload it to CTM
# a.open an IE browser and log in to the CUCM
#b.when security alert window pops , click View Certificate
c.click Details at the Certificate pop up
d.click Copy to File on the bottom right corner
e.click Next, and leave the default DER encoded binary X.509(.CER),
click Next
f.pick a folder and enter ccm-cert as file name from Browse and click
Save
g.click Next, Finish, Ok
Go to the folder and find ccm-cert.cer, change it to ccm-cert.der
Then use your .der file during the connection test with your hostname/ip of cucm and app user logs.

05-04-2011 08:06 AM
When you get the certificate from your browser, the extension format doesnt really matter ( .crt/.cer ... ). You just need to change it to ".der" after downloading it on your computer.
The certificate is generated by the cucm so yeah it's self-signed.

I had the same problem.
In the documentation it doesn't say you have to enter the digest password as well, but when I did the authentication works fine.
the stupid thing is that for the prequalification assistant you don't have to enter the digest passwd for it to work..
